Can pumpkins be grown indoors? Pumpkins can be grown indoors with proper care and attention. They need plenty of sunlight, so a south-facing window or grow light is essential. The temperature should be kept between 65 and 75 degrees Fahrenheit. Pumpkins need well-drained soil and should be watered regularly. Fertilize them every few weeks with[…]

What are the potential risks of consuming expired chia seeds? Consuming expired chia seeds poses potential health hazards. They may become rancid, harboring bacteria or mold, which can cause gastrointestinal distress, nausea, vomiting, and other symptoms. The nutritional value of expired chia seeds diminishes over time, reducing their health benefits. Additionally, they may develop an[…]

Are pumpkin blossoms safe to eat? Pumpkin blossoms are the edible flowers of pumpkin plants, offering a unique and flavorful culinary experience. The blossoms are delicate, with a mild, slightly sweet taste. They can be enjoyed raw in salads or as a garnish, or cooked in a variety of dishes. The blossoms are rich in[…]
